Solution for 4x-5=2x+4+x-8 equation:



4x-5=2x+4+x-8
We move all terms to the left:
4x-5-(2x+4+x-8)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
4x-(3x-4)-5=0
We get rid of parentheses
4x-3x+4-5=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
x-1=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
x=1
